Buying Guide

Key considerations when choosing a lemon meringue pie book or related title include format, audience, and goals. The five selections above span fiction, recipe collections, and practical guides, so readers should weigh these factors:

  • Format and accessibility: If you prefer physical books, the mass market paperback may suit casual reading; for quick reference while baking, Kindle editions offer searchable, on‑demand access.
  • Content focus: Cozy mysteries weave dessert themes into narrative, while recipe books emphasize techniques, measurements, and troubleshooting. Determine whether you want fiction, practical guidance, or a blend.
  • Skill level and clarity: Look for books that clearly explain custard texture, lemon balance, crust blind baking, and meringue stability. For beginners, step‑by‑step photos or detailed troubleshooting tips are beneficial.
  • Ingredient guidance: Some titles emphasize pantry staples and substitutions, useful for home cooks with dietary considerations or ingredient availability constraints.
  • Audience alignment: Fiction selections may appeal to mystery readers who enjoy culinary backdrops, whereas cookbook editions target bakers seeking consistent results and confidence in lemon desserts.
